Yeah the tranny really holds it back BUT its actually not different than the fiesta. Ive posted this about a thousand times around the internet but if you look at the mile from epa.gov the Fiesta and the 2 at the same package and price get the same mileage. That is until you up the Fiesta to the special efficient package. but that is also like 5k more than the highest price Mazda2.
